Abstract

The research activity was implemented at BNI Perguruan Tinggi Bandung to assess the the contribution of internal control and the implementation of Good Corporate Governance (GCG) on fraud prevention within the banking sector. The research was driven by the increasing number of fraud cases, including the misuse of CSR funds and customer account breaches, which reflect weaknesses in oversight mechanisms and governance practices in state-owned banks. This research aims to examine how internal control and good corporate governance influence fraud prevention. A quantitative methodology with a survey approach employed in this research gathered data by means of questionnaires administered to respondents. and subsequently analyzed using validity and reliability tests, multiple linear regression, and the both the coefficient of determination and the t-test as well as the F-test. The findings evidence suggests that internal control exerts a considerable impact on fraud prevention. positive impact on fraud prevention, whereas GCG demonstrates an effect that is not statistically significant. However, when examined simultaneously, both variables influence fraud prevention, underscoring the importance of strengthening internal systems and governance practices to foster a transparent and fraud-resistant organizational environment.
